If your PS3 has four USB ports and a serial number starting with C, D, or E, then you MAY be able to play some PS2 games.

The models with most backwards compatibility are: If your PS3 has four USB ports, it IS backwards compatible-but the degree to which it's backwards compatible depends on the specific model of your PS3. If your PS3 only has two USB ports, we regret to inform you that it is NOT backwards compatible with PS2 games. Another way is to count the USB ports on your PS3. How can you tell if your PS3 can play PS2 games? One way is to pop a PS2 game into the disc slot and hope for the best. But backwards compatibility was ALSO dropped from certain "fat" models as well. You might be aware that backwards compatibility for PS2 games was dropped when Sony moved from the original "fat" PlayStation 3 to the PlayStation 3 Slim. That's because different PS3 models have different levels of backwards compatibility. That said, just because you have a PlayStation 3 doesn't mean you can necessarily play PS2 games on it.
